To the Worshipfull the Chairman and others his Majesty's Justices of the Peace
of the County of Middx
in their General Quarter Sessions of the peace assembled
The Hamble Petition of Abel Aldridge< no role >
Gent
Sheweth
That your Petitioner hath Served the office of High Constable
in and for
Uxbridge Division
in the Hundred of Elthorne
for three years of all but about three Months.
That your Petitioners private affairs calling him Very Much from home and out
of the County of Middx
at this time will Render him uncapable to perform his Duty
without Great prejudice to himself
That your Petitioner hath Nominated Mr Joseph Cook< no role >
of Uxbridge
Gent
Mr Edward Ashley< no role >
of the Same Gent
& Mr Nicholas Mercer< no role >
of the same Gent
to Serve the office of High Constable in his place and Stead
Your Petitioner therefore Humbly prays your Worships will please
to Take the premisses into Consideration and Discharge him from
the Office of High Constable
Mr Aldridge has paid the
County Rate
J. Higgs
And your Petitioner shall ever Pray Ect.
A Aldridge
